How do I configure network segmentation in Kubernetes clusters?

Network segmentation in Kubernetes clusters can be achieved using network policies, which allow you to control the communication between pods and services. This approach enhances security by limiting access based on defined rules.
Example Concept: Kubernetes Network Policies are used to define how groups of pods are allowed to communicate with each other and with other network endpoints. By default, pods are non-isolated and can communicate with any other pod. Network policies enable you to specify rules that restrict traffic, effectively segmenting the network. These policies are implemented by network plugins that support the NetworkPolicy API, such as Calico, Cilium, or Weave Net.

- Network policies are defined as Kubernetes resources and can be applied using YAML manifests.
- Ensure your chosen CNI (Container Network Interface) plugin supports network policies.
- Test network policies in a staging environment to verify they enforce the desired segmentation.
- Use labels to select pods for which the network policies apply, allowing for flexible and dynamic segmentation.
- Regularly review and update network policies to adapt to changes in your application architecture.
